Our Network in St. Louis
Segra’s fiber network spans the St. Louis metro area, serving key business districts including Downtown, Clayton, Creve Coeur, Chesterfield, and St. Charles. Our footprint continues to expand as more organizations upgrade to high-performance fiber.

Does Segra offer symmetrical speeds?
Yes. Segra’s fiber solutions provide symmetrical upload and download speeds—which is critical for IT leaders managing cloud applications, video collaboration, data transfers, and multi-site operations.
